AirTrain from JFK to Jamaica.
Now, at Jamaica, you have options! One is to take the Long Archipelago Rail Road from Jamaica to Penn Station. On Saturday and Sunday, the fare is a moment ago $3.25 - select "CityTicket" when buying your ticket!! You'll be at Penn Status in 20 minutes if you use the LIRR. If you're going near there, especially on SAT/SUN with the low fare, that's a great choosing.
You can also get the E/J/Z subway from Jamaica, depending on where you need to go. The E often works well for most people, because you can transfer to almost anything from it, and it goes right through midtown and downtown. It also runs show through Queens, though it can sometimes run local on weekends.
But yeah, ride it, don't worry, it's a great way to go, and is frequently in use accustomed to by air travelers from JFK - that's what the AirTrain was built for! It sure beats paying $45+ for a taxi!
